Understanding LED Strip Types

Before choosing a product, it helps to know what you’re looking at. LED strips come in many variants, and each serves a different purpose.

  • Voltage options: You’ll usually find 12V and 24V strips for indoor use, and 220V options for long runs in commercial or outdoor settings. The right voltage depends on your layout and power supply.
  • SMD vs COB strips: SMD (Surface Mounted Device) strips are the most common, offering bright, modular lighting. COB (Chip-on-Board) strips, on the other hand, provide more uniform illumination with fewer visible dots ideal for clean lines or backlighting.
  • Neon-style strips and RGB: For more decorative or eye-catching designs, silicone-encased neon LED strips give a soft, diffused look. RGB options offer dynamic color changes and are perfect for mood lighting or events.
  • IP Ratings and build quality: If you’re installing strips outdoors or in high-humidity areas, check for IP65, IP67, or IP68 ratings. These indicate resistance to water and dust.

What Exactly Is an LED Module?

An LED module is a small circuit that includes one or more LED emitters mounted on a board usually with lenses, resistors, and sometimes waterproof coatings. They’re used in applications where pinpoint or compact lighting is needed, such as signage, logos, and display backlighting.

Unlike LED strips, modules are usually installed individually or in clusters to highlight specific areas. They’re designed for durability and long-term performance, even in harsh outdoor conditions.

In most setups, the choice of led module depends on size constraints, the type of surface being illuminated, and how focused or diffused the lighting needs to be.

Key Specs to Look for in LED Modules

If you’re planning to use LED modules in your project, it’s worth getting familiar with the core specifications:

  • Voltage and power requirements: Common LED modules run at low voltages, such as 12V or 24V, making them safe and energy-efficient. Ensure that your power source matches these needs.
  • Color temperature and beam angle: LED modules can offer cool white, warm white, RGB, or even full-color outputs. Consider where and how the light will be used. A wide beam angle provides better spread, while a narrower one offers more focus.
  • Brightness and CRI: Brightness is measured in lumens, and a higher Color Rendering Index (CRI) means colors will appear more natural under the light important for displays and branding.
  • Durability: If the module is exposed to weather or moisture, look for waterproof designs and high-quality housing materials. An IP68-rated module, for example, is fully protected against dust and prolonged water immersion.

Innovations in LED Module Design

Technology never stands still. The LED module market has seen some major improvements in recent years, such as:

  • Miniaturization and flexibility: Modules are now smaller and more adaptable, making them easier to install even in tight or curved spaces.
  • Higher efficiency: With better chips and thermal management, some modules now reach luminous efficacy of over 180–200 lumens per watt, translating to lower power consumption and higher brightness.
  • Environmental improvements: More manufacturers are shifting to eco-friendlier materials and designs, focusing on recyclable plastics and lower energy footprints.
